Consider the possibilities of joining a Great Place to Work! Provides administrative and clerical support to a funeral home, cemetery, crematory or a combination of these facilities.
JOB RESPONSIBILITIES Prepare records checks for burial and placements Checking all records for accuracy and completeness Filing of physical records Receives and processes payments and contracts Ordering of, and the control of burial vaults Oversees the processing of interment orders to grounds and maintenance departments Processes accounts payable transactions Assists Location Management, Sales, Family Service Counselors as needed Acts as backup to Phone Receptionist Responds to customer inquiries via telephone MINIMUM REQUIREMENTS Education High School or equivalent Knowledge, Skills & Abilities Working knowledge of office equipment including computers, calculators, copiers, printers, and fax machines at a level consistent with experience Some typing on typewriter Basic mathematics skills required Good verbal and written communication skills Strong organizational skills and detail oriented High level of compassion and integrity Ability to maintain confidentiality Job Type:

Don't Be Fooled

The fraudster will send a check to the victim who has accepted a job. The check can be for multiple reasons such as signing bonus, supplies, etc. The victim will be instructed to deposit the check and use the money for any of these reasons and then instructed to send the remaining funds to the fraudster. The check will bounce and the victim is left responsible.
